Output 08d130504d33a5636004939b3b68ab125dea79e24ad131186a651a2123dac289:1

value
39000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4e9659a3b2abb22bf97dc2cf401c829cb25d5f7c OP_EQUALVERIFY OP_CHECKSIG
address
18AXpUXcfv37GjWWP4FbJ5CeDvU6EY2WoS
transaction
08d130504d33a5636004939b3b68ab125dea79e24ad131186a651a2123dac289
spent
true